Introduction:
The 2022 Ancient Peaks Sauvignon Blanc from Santa Margarita Ranch in Paso Robles, California, is a vibrant expression of this classic varietal. Crafted by Ancient Peaks Winery, this wine reflects the unique terroir of the estate's Margarita Vineyard.
Terroir:
The Margarita Vineyard is characterized by rocky alluvium soils, contributing to the wine's distinct minerality. The vineyard's location benefits from a marine-influenced climate, with cool breezes moderating the warm Paso Robles days, allowing for balanced ripening of the Sauvignon Blanc grapes.
Appearance:
Pale straw yellow with greenish reflections, indicating freshness and youth.
Nose:
Aromas of grapefruit, peach skin, and tropical papaya, complemented by subtle notes of green apple and a hint of grassiness.
Palate:
The mouthfeel is beautifully textured, featuring flavors of citrus, green apple, and pineapple. A crisp acidity balances the fruit profile, while a mineral undertone adds complexity.
Finish:
A bright, tangy finish with lingering notes of citrus and a refreshing acidity.
Overall Impression:
The 2022 Ancient Peaks Sauvignon Blanc is a well-balanced and expressive wine, showcasing the harmonious interplay between ripe fruit flavors and refreshing acidity. Its vibrant character makes it an excellent companion to seafood dishes, light salads, or as an aperitif.

Winemaking Techniques: The grapes were harvested between August 15 and September 9, 2022. After cold fermentation at 55°F to retain delicate aromatics and pure fruit flavors, the wine was aged for three months in stainless steel tanks to preserve textural crispness.
